Title: Innovator Spotlight: Niklas Svedin – Pioneering Advancements in MEMS Technology
Introduction: Niklas Svedin, an accomplished inventor based in Stockholm, Sweden, has made significant contributions to the field of micro-electromechanical systems (MEMS) technology. With a remarkable portfolio of 11 patents, he exemplifies the spirit of innovation that drives advancements in contemporary engineering and technology.
Latest Patents: Among his latest innovations, Niklas has developed groundbreaking patents that detail sophisticated mechanisms for MEMS devices. One of his notable inventions, titled "Thin capping for MEMS devices," involves a base substrate with an attached micro component. This invention incorporates routing elements for signal conduction and spacer members that serve dual roles as conducting structures for vertical signal routing. A unique capping structure made from glass material is positioned above the base substrate, bonded through eutectic bonding with the spacer members. This design includes vias containing metal for electrical connections, which can be fabricated using various methods such as stamping, drilling, or etching.
Another key patent from Niklas is "Thin film capping," which presents a method for sealing cavities in MEMS devices to maintain a controlled atmosphere. This method involves creating a defined cavity shape using a template on a semiconductor substrate. By introducing holes for venting, a desired atmosphere can fill the cavity, and the sealing is achieved through compression or melting of sealing material.
Career Highlights: Niklas Svedin has built a strong career within influential companies in the tech sector, notably contributing to Silex Microsystems AB and Silex Microsystems AG. His work in these organizations has enabled him to push the boundaries of what is possible in MEMS technology, demonstrating his commitment to innovation and excellence.
Collaborations: Throughout his career, Niklas has collaborated with esteemed colleagues, including Thorbjörn Ebefors and Edvard Kälvesten. Their joint efforts have facilitated the development of cutting-edge solutions that continue to impact the MEMS landscape.
